Job Description
We are currently seeking a Part 1 and Part 2 Scaffolder for a traditional new build housing site in Stowmarket, Suffolk.
Job Details:
Position Available: 1x Part 1 Scaffolder & 1x Part 2 Scaffolder
Work Scope: Traditional new build housing site
Rate: £24 per hour (Part 1) – £26 per hour (Part 2)
Hours: 8:00 AM – 4:00 PM
Duration: 3 weeks
Start Date: Monday 21st July 2025
